What version of Chrome do I have Windows 7?

1) Click on the Menu icon in the upper right corner of the screen. 2) Click on Help, and then About Google Chrome. 3) Your Chrome browser version number can be found here.

How can I tell what version of Chrome I have?

If there’s no alert, but you want to know which version of Chrome you’re running, click the three-dot icon in the top-right corner and select Help > About Google Chrome. On mobile, tap Settings > About Chrome (Android) or Settings > Google Chrome (iOS).

How can I download Google Chrome for free on Windows 7?

Install Chrome on Windows

  1. Download the installation file.
  2. If prompted, click Run or Save.
  3. If you chose Save, double-click the download to start installing.
  4. Start Chrome: Windows 7: A Chrome window opens once everything is done. Windows 8 & 8.1: A welcome dialog appears. Click Next to select your default browser.

How much RAM do I need for chrome?

You don’t need 32 GB of memory to run chrome, but you will need more than 2.5 GB available. If looking for a new computer or upgrading an older one, consider getting at least 8 GB installed memory for a smooth Chrome experience. 16 GB if you like to have other applications open in the background.

Is it OK to use Windows 7?

If you use a Microsoft laptop or desktop running Windows 7, your security is already obsolete. Microsoft officially ended support for that operating system on Jan. 14, which means that the company no longer offers technical assistance or software updates to your device — including security updates and patches.

How can update Google Chrome in Windows 7?

To update Google Chrome:

  1. On your computer, open Chrome.
  2. At the top right, click More .
  3. Click Update Google Chrome. Important: If you can’t find this button, you’re on the latest version.
  4. Click Relaunch.

What are the minimum system requirements for Google Chrome?

Google Chrome will run on computers equipped with a Pentium 4 processor or higher, which encompasses most machines manufactured since 2001. The computer must have approximately 100MB of free hard drive space and 128MB of RAM. The oldest version of Windows supported by Chrome is Windows XP with Service Pack 2 installed.

What operating system does chrome use?

Chrome OS is built on top of the Linux kernel. Originally based on Ubuntu, its base was changed to Gentoo Linux in February 2010.

Where is the File menu in Chrome?

If you mean the File Edit etc., unlike Firefox and Internet Explorer, Chrome does not have a traditional menu bar. Instead, additional features can be accessed by clicking the More button (three dots in a vertical line) on the top right of the browser below the window close (X) button.

What is the difference between Chrome and Google?

Chrome is based on an open-source project called “Chromium,” which is technically open software and, a bit like Android, can be installed without proprietary Google additions or forked into different variants without Google’s permission, but is in practice mostly built and maintained by Google.
